Eastern Montgomery hasn't had much luck against Auburn recently, but that could start to change on Wednesday. The Mustangs will be playing in front of their home fans against the Eagles at 5:00 p.m. Eastern Montgomery is strutting in with some hitting muscle as they've averaged 7.5 runs per game this season.
Last Thursday, Eastern Montgomery came up short against Bland County and fell 9-5.
Caleb Jones was cooking despite his team's loss, going a perfect 4-for-4 with five stolen bases, two runs, and two doubles. Coltin Conner was another key player, going 2-for-4 with two RBI, one run, and one double.
Meanwhile, Auburn lost 11-4 to Patrick Henry on Tuesday. The game marked the Eagles' lowest-scoring contest so far this season.
Eastern Montgomery's defeat dropped their record down to 3-3. As for Auburn, their loss dropped their record down to 4-2.
Eastern Montgomery might still be hurting after the 7-0 defeat they got from Auburn when the teams last played back in May of 2023. Will the Mustangs have more luck at home instead of on the road?
